The Kids of Curtis #0842

…youthful students from the Curtis Institute of Music perform at Spivey Hall in Morrow, Georgia, while their teacher, Alan Morrison, premieres a new work back home at Philadelphia’s Verizon Hall.

Part 1

PRINCE JOHANN ERNST (transcribed by J.S. BACH): Concerto in G, S. 592 –Daniel Razionale (1992 Ruffatti/Spivey Hall, Clayton State University, Morrow, GA) recorded April 12, 2008

CHARLES IVES: Variations on America –Stephanie Liem (1992 Ruffatti/Spivey Hall, Clayton State University, Morrow, GA) recorded April 12, 2008

NAJI HAKIM: Te Deum –Joshua Stafford (1992 Ruffatti/Spivey Hall, Clayton State University, Morrow, GA) recorded April 12, 2008

Part 2

ERIC SESSLER: Organ Concerto, premiere –Curtis Symphony Orchestra, David Hayes, conductor; Alan Morrison (Fred J. Cooper Memorial Organ [2006 Dobson]/Verizon Hall at the Kimmel Center for the Performing Arts, Philadelphia, PA) recorded April 12, 2007

Part 3

HAROLD STOVER: Quick Dance, from Mountain Music. DANIEL CROZIER: Cantilena –Alan Morrison, recorded May 8, 2005 (1992 Ruffatti/Spivey Hall, Clayton State University, Morrow, GA) ACA Digital 20094

JOSEPH JONGEN: Sonata Eroica, Opus 94 –Nathan Laube (1992 Ruffatti/Spivey Hall, Clayton State University, Morrow, GA) recorded April 12, 2008
